Marketing finalists revealed for PPS Awards 2019

The six finalists for the marketing award in this year’s Progressive Preschool Awards have been revealed, highlighting the campaigns which have made an impressive impact upon the preschool product and retail sector over the past 12 months.

The judging itself saw a carefully selected group of marketing experts coming together in a face-to-face panel discussion to arrive at the final six.

“The judges found arriving at their decision to be a challenge, as the quality of entries gets better and better each year,” said Richard Pink, marketing guru and owner of Pink Key Marketing, who has been chairing the marketing judging panel for the past five years.

He continued; “But after a long and passionate debate they reached a result that everyone was happy with – a very deserving set of finalists and ultimate winner.”

The list of finalists reflect the broad cross-category nature of the Preschool Awards, which spanning a wide selection of nursery, toy, licensing and other activity.

The winners will be revealed at the Progressive Preschool Awards ceremony on Tuesday 5 November, 2019 at the Grosvenor House Hotel, Mayfair. Tickets and tables can be organised via the online box office.

The Progressive Preschool Awards 2019 – Marketing Finalists

  • Entertainment One with Peppa Pig’s Festival of Fun campaign
  • Entertainment One with PJ Masks’ Small Space Day at the National Space Centre
  • Nanas Manners’ Handy Hints for Starting Nursery and School
  • Rocket Licensing with The Very Hungry Caterpillar weekend at The Eden Project
  • The Entertainer with The Big Toy Rehoming
  • WildBrain with Teletubbies’ Baby Sensory/Toddler Sense
